Description

Slanted back; braided crest rail curves down to arms and down front of chair to cone-shaped feet; criss-cross wicker forms seat back and sides; woven wicker apron curves at corners above legs shorter cone-shaped back legs; woven seat bottom; varnished; white linen covered cushions.
